I'm trying hard to blame this on my own prejudices as a liberal. "This," of course, refers to my creeping suspicion that the Republican Convention — to be fair, a spectacle no longer fully affiliated with the mainstream of the GOP — is less about the convening of a major political party to crown its nominee, and more a co-opted, neo-fascist rally headed by a man so incapable of personal humility or fundamental morality that it is no longer an exaggeration to compare the current Trump love-in with the early rise of the Nazi Party in Germany. Indeed, what is occurring in the Republican establishment can easily be compared to what happened within Germany's Weimar political system in early 1930s Germany, wherein an increasingly hysterical elite elected to remain in a state of denial, appeasement and compromise while the fringe elements in the culture began their process of open and unapologetic fascist rhetoric that ended, well, we all know where. Indeed, we as a nation have been comforting ourselves up until this point by pretending that Trump is a singular threat; a showman who has taken advantage of a disenfranchised and enraged minority, all by himself, with little support from any thinking American. Then came Cleveland, where a steady flood of incomprehensibly bigoted members of the party have stood up and screamed for rivers of blood in front of an ever more frothy crowd. People who are awful, but smart enough to know better — among them former House Speaker Newt Gingrich, current House Speaker Paul Ryan, and current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ell — have committed themselves to a sort of cultural genocide that any cognitive American should see as an opening salvo in a war against people of color, LGBTQ individuals, women, liberals and, yes, even moderate conservatives. With all the calls for walls, the bizarre jingoistic rhetoric regarding our fight against ISIS — Gingrich spent a significant chunk of his speech listing all the deaths of Westerners in recent terrorist attacks, but conveniently neglected to mention the murder of black people at the hands of police officers — as well as the usual coded language about American exceptionalism and how "we" are going to take "our" country back (the implication being, of course, that it has been overrun by nasty brown people who don't belong here) it's hard to say who has provided the most vile invective to the flock of tin-hatters in enthusiastic attendance at the Quicken Loans Arena. But that prize should probably go to Al Baldasaro, a New Hampshire representative who serves on Trump's veterans' coalition. On Tuesday, Baldasaro stood before a crowd and said, categorically, that presumptive Democratic nominee Hillary Clinton should be "shot for treason" by a firing squad. That particular statement now has him under investigation by the Secret Service. More harrowing, however, is the fact that Baldasaro's comment has not been met with any vocal resistance from the Trump campaign. The pattern of cynical exploitation by Trump and his proxies that has roiled the blood of America's bigoted class has now resulted in an elected official calling for the execution of a former first lady, senator and secretary of state, with no hint of remorse from the campaign. So they are implicitly supporting calls for the murder of people who disagree with them politically. In America. In 2016. As such, Trump, his campaign and anyone who supports it have lost the right to participate in the political process. They are officially, conspicuously corrupt. They're not contributing to a democratic process in a healthy way. Can we now, at long last, say "You're fired," and move on?
